This book contains many quotations: over 150 works by Marx, Engels, Lenin, Stalin, Hoxha, and others, with more than 650 quoted passages. They are here to serve the argument, not to replace it. The reader who memorizes the quotes without following the method will have learned nothing — and will have repeated the very error this book was written to expose.

Marx wrote that 'the weapons with which the bourgeoisie felled feudalism to the ground are now turned against the bourgeoisie itself.' The same is true of the quotes in this book. They are not there for decoration. They are there to be used — against those who have used them to distort, to confuse, and to divide."

This book is a compilation of various articles, some going back a decade, updated to the present. It will not be commercially published for two reasons. First, due to its page count, the cost of printing would be prohibitive. Second, and more importantly, the price would place it beyond the reach of the average reader.

A book about ideological warfare that is accessible only to those who can afford it would have already lost the battle it describes. Our task, as Marxist-Leninist writers, is to make our writings available and accessible to the largest number of the masses — either affordably or, best of all, free of charge. This book is therefore distributed as a free PDF. It is given, not sold.
